Hepatic uptake mediated by organic anion transporting polypeptide (OATP) 1B1 and 1B3 can serve as a major elimination pathway for various anionic drugs and as a site of drug-drug interactions (DDIs). This article provides an overview of the in vitro approaches used to predict human hepatic clearance (CLh) and the risk of DDIs involving OATP1Bs. On the basis of the so-called extended clearance concept, in vitro–in vivo extrapolation methods using human hepatocytes as in vitro systems have been used to predict the CLh involving OATP1B-mediated hepatic uptake. CLh can be quantitatively predicted using human donor lots possessing adequate OATP1B activities. The contribution of OATP1Bs to hepatic uptake can be estimated by the relative activity factor, the relative expression factor, or selective inhibitor approaches, which offer generally consistent outcomes. In OATP1B1 inhibition assays, substantial substrate dependency was observed. The time-dependent inhibition of OATP1B1 was also noted and may be a mechanism underlying the in vitro–in vivo differences in the inhibition constant of cyclosporine A. Although it is still challenging to quantitatively predict CLh and DDIs involving OATP1Bs from only preclinical data, understanding the utility and limitation of the current in vitro methods will pave the way for better prediction. 相似文献

This study evaluated the genetic variation of 17 autosomal short tandem repeat (STR) loci included in the PowerPlex® 18D Kit. Samples of 562 unrelated healthy Lahu individuals living in Yunnan Province in southwestern China were investigated. The data were analyzed to provide information on allele frequencies and other statistical parameters relevant to the forensic population. Of the 17 loci, 16 reached the Hardy–Weinberg equilibrium after Bonferroni correction. A total of 176 alleles were identified in 17 STR loci, and allele frequencies ranged from 0.000 890 to 0.578 292. The combined discrimination power (CPD) and probability of excluding paternity (CPE) of the 17 STR loci were 0.999 999 999 999 999 999 489 and 0.999 998 301 753 122. The genetic relationships among 28 populations were also estimated. 相似文献

Matrix metalloproteinase-11 (MMP11) is an enzyme with proteolytic activity against matrix and nonmatrix proteins. Although most MMPs are secreted as inactive proenzymes and are later activated extracellularly, MMP11 is activated intracellularly by furin within the constitutive secretory pathway. It is a key factor in physiological tissue remodeling and its alteration may play an important role in the progression of epithelial malignancies and other diseases. TCGA colon and colorectal adenocarcinoma data showed that upregulation of MMP11 expression correlates with tumorigenesis and malignancy. Here, we provide evidence that a germline variant in the MMP11 gene (NM_005940: c.232C>T; p.(Pro78Ser)), identified by whole exome sequencing, can increase the tumorigenic properties of colorectal cancer (CRC) cells. P78S is located in the prodomain region, which is responsible for blocking MMP11's protease activity. This variant was detected in the proband and all the cancer-affected family members analyzed, while it was not detected in healthy relatives. In silico analyses predict that P78S could have an impact on the activation of the enzyme. Furthermore, our in vitro analyses show that the expression of P78S in HCT116 cells increases tumor cell invasion and proliferation. In summary, our results show that this variant could modify the structure of the MMP11 prodomain, producing a premature or uncontrolled activation of the enzyme that may contribute to an early CRC onset in these patients. The study of this gene in other CRC cases will provide further information about its role in CRC development, which might improve patient treatment in the future. 相似文献

ObjectivesThis document presents the fundamentals of speech audiometry in noise, general requirements for implementation and criteria for choice among the tests available in French according to the health-professional's needs.Material and methodsThe recommendations are based on a systematic analysis of the literature carried out by a multidisciplinary group of doctors, audiologists and audioprosthetists from all over France. They are graded A, B, C or expert opinion according to decreasing level of scientific evidence.ResultsEight tests of speech audiometry in noise can be used in France.ConclusionTo be complete, evaluation of hearing status requires testing understanding of speech in noise. The examination must begin with a minimum of two measurements familiarizing the subject with the test procedure. For initial diagnosis, adaptive procedures establishing the 50% speech reception threshold (SRT50) in noise are to be preferred in order to obtain a rapid and standardized measurement of perception of speech in noise. When the aim is to measure real-life speech comprehension, tests based on sentences, cocktail-party noise and free-field stimulation are to be preferred. Prosthetic gain is evaluated exclusively in free field. This is the only way to evaluate the contribution of binaurality and to measure perception in noise in an environment as close as possible to real life. In order to avoid acoustic interference in free field, at least five loudspeakers should be used, in particular for evaluating the effectiveness of directional microphones, CROS devices enabling sounds picked up in the damaged ear to be rerouted to the functional ear, or bimodal fitting (i.e., when hearing is enabled by two modalities: for example, hearing aid for one ear, cochlear implant for the other). 相似文献

目的:探讨园艺互动干预应用于维持性血液透析病人中的效果。方法:选择本院收治的行维持性血液透析病人157例,按照入院时间先后顺序分为对照组77例,观察组80例。对照组实施常规干预,观察组实施园艺互动干预。对比两组干预前后心理状态、应对方式、生活质量及总体幸福感变化。结果:观察组干预12周后症状自评量表(SCL-90)各维度评分低于对照组(P<0.05);观察组干预12周后积极应对评分高于对照组,消极应对评分低于对照组(P<0.05);观察组生活质量各维度评分高于对照组(P<0.05);观察组总体幸福感评分高于对照组(P<0.05)。结论:园艺互动干预应用于维持性血液透析病人可改善心理状态及应对方式,提升生活质量与总体幸福感。 相似文献
